Greg, I agree with Jeff and Oscar.

The Prospex line of Tunas, including the SBBN017 that you are considering, is going to be considerably better built than the Baby Tuna line. You really can't compare the two, but the price points aren't really comparable either.

The Baby Tuna line is not bad for what it is...I have the SRP453...a cool piece, but I'm looking to get rid of the plastic shroud that comes on it and replacing it with an aftermarket metal shroud.
